There seem to be many people who have sailed RCCL on the Azamara cruises. We really don't like RCCL and don't want to go on anything resembling them. We know Azamara is owned by them, but are under the impression it's a totally different product.

 

Can anyone somewhat clarify this - we would really appreciate it.

Hi Alidor !

 

Yes, Azamara is owned by RCCL, but it is a very different product. While RCCL offers a very good product, it is a very hectic Cruise experience, and they cater to families. Azamara is a much smaller, and cozier ship, which features great service and excellent cuisine. They also have very limited smoking areas. Overall, it is a far more relaxing Cruise experience. i find the main difference between azamara & rccl is azamara is a smaller ship with better service,however entertainment in my opinion is lacking as is the food. many people will disagree with me but my standards are quite high. if you really want a different cruise experience & can afford it look at seabourne,they truly are a premium cruise.

if you really want a different cruise experience & can afford it look at seabourne,they truly are a premium cruise.

Or look at Crystal :D. Azamara is Royal Caribbean International’s premiere product. As such, it is superior to RCCL (I've been there twice). The food was excellent in all venues, way better than RCCL. Entertainment is limited on Azamara, just as it is on Seabourn. It consists of cabaret-style shows. Small ships do not have room for much else. Still, I enjoyed all the shows onboard the Journey, as well as the enrichment lectures.

Alidor, keep in mind that Azamara's connection to Royal Caribbean International is similar to that of Seaborn, Cunard, Princess, HAL, etc. to big daddy Carnival Corporation & PLC. Just like QM2 differs from a Carnival cruise ship, Azamara differs from RCCL. Just my $0.02.
